bac•te•ri•o•rho•dop•sinbækˌtɪər i oʊ roʊˈdɒp sɪn(n.)

  1. a protein complex that contains retinal and is used by halobacteria for photosynthesis instead of chlorophyll.

  1. bacteriorhodopsin(Noun)

    Any of several related purple photosynthetic proteins, found in halobacteria, that act as proton pumps.
